Determination of the Average Daily PV System Load. 1. Identify all loads to be connected to the PV System. 2. For each load determine its voltage, current, power and daily operating hours. For some loads the operation may vary on a daily, monthly or seasonal basis. If so accounted by calculating daily averages.

Primary transmission. The electric power at 132 kV is transmitted by 3-phase, 3-wire overhead system to the outskirts of the city.This forms the primary transmission. Secondary transmission. The primary transmission line terminates at the receiving station (RS) which usually lies at the outskirts of the city.At the receiving station, the voltage is reduced to 33kV by step-down transformers.

The major components of a power electronic system are shown in the form of a block diagram. The primary power source might be an alternating current (AC) or direct current (DC) supply system. The output of the power electronic circuit might be changeable dc or alternating current voltage, or it can be variable voltage and frequency.

An electrical power grid is an interconnected network that delivers the generated power to the consumers. It is, sometimes, also called as an electrical power system.A power grid consists of generating stations (power plants), transmission system and distribution system.
